About Icef Vista Middle Academy
Icef Vista Middle Academy is a public middle school in Los Angeles, CA, part of Icef Vista Middle Academy District, serving approximately 204 students in grades 6th-8th with a 18.5: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 9.5 out of 10 and ranks #22 of 9,539 schools in CA. State assessment records show 42%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2024) and 55%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2024).
